Cost of Attendance (COA)

For academic year 2022-2023, the tuition & fees is $13,275 at Allied Health Careers Institute. 66 % students out of total 63 undergraduate students received financial aid(grants or scholarship) and the average amount of the aid is $3,963.
The living costs including room, board, and other expenses are $27,201 when a student lives off campus at Allied Health Careers Institute. The total cost of attendance (COA) is $41,976 before receiving financial aid and the net price with financial aid is $38,013.

Allied Health Careers Institute 2023 Largest Program Tuition & Fees

The largest program at Allied Health Careers Institute is Practical Nursing, Vocational Nursing and Nursing Assistants (other) and its tuition & fees is $10,625 and the books & supplies cost is $1,500. The total length of the program 16 weeks as completed (full-time attending status) and the average number of months to complete the program is 16 months. The next table shows the average tuition & fees for 4 largest programs at Allied Health Careers Institute.
2022-2023 Largest Program Tuition & fees at Allied Health Careers Institute
Tuition & FeesBooks & Supplies Costs
Practical Nursing, Vocational Nursing and Nursing Assistants (other)$10,625$1,500
Phlebotomy Technician/Phlebotomist$1,225$300
Medical/Clinical Assistant$6,475$1,020
Medical Insurance Coding Specialist/Coder$6,525$1,000
